Predicting the results of round 21 of Premier League: Liverpool loses points, Arsenal follows closely

According to Chris Sutton, England’s leading football expert, top team Liverpool will have a difficult trip to the field of the in-form team Bournemouth and will be divided points. Meanwhile, Arsenal is predicted to win to stay close to the top of the table.

The earliest to play this weekend is the London derby between Arsenal vs Crystal Palace. After going through a streak of 3 consecutive matches without winning in the Premier League (4 matches in all competitions), the Gunners lost the top position to Liverpool and even fell to 4th on the rankings with a gap of 5 points. 3 points behind Man City’s second place in the table.

However, this round Arsenal has a chance to end their series of poor matches, having only had a two-week “recharge” period, helping the pillars have the best physical foundation. Mikel Arteta’s team returns to England after the winter break in Abu Dhabi and will welcome neighboring team Crystal Palace, who just had a difficult match against Everton in midweek in the FA Cup third round replay and admit defeat.

According to expert Sutton: “Of course, there are question marks for Mikel Arteta’s army after their recent results, especially in attack when they fail to take advantage of opportunities. I want to see Arsenal in the race championship title and challenge Man City at the end of the season. For that to happen, they will improve their attack and I think the Gunners can find a way to penetrate Palace’s defense.”

The highlight of the Premier League this weekend is the match between Bournemouth and Liverpool. The last time they welcomed Liverpool at Vitality’s home ground in the Premier League, Bournemouth players won 2-1 in March 2023. That was also this team’s only victory against the opponent, when they lost the remaining 9 matches, including the loss in the first leg this season and the defeat in the English League Cup not long after.

However, at the present time, Bouenrmouth is having a very convincing performance with a record of winning 5/6 matches played in all competitions. This may be a necessary boost for coach Andoni Iraola’s team to welcome Liverpool without striker Mohamed Salah as well as midfielder Wataru Endo due to being busy with the national team participating in the CAN and Asian Cup.

According to experts’ predictions, despite being in quite convincing form recently, Liverpool will likely face difficulties in their away trip to Bournemouth’s stadium: “We see how Man City did when they were not has had Erling Haaland in attack for the past few weeks – now it’s Liverpool’s turn to deal without Mohamed Salah, who returned to participate in CAN 2023 with the Egyptian national team. The Red Devils are also without the injured Trent Alexander-Arnold, which is a problem. Another big loss, especially for a difficult match like this one.”

“This will be a real test for Jurgen Klopp’s side. Bournemouth lost to Tottenham in their last match at the start of the year, but they created enough chances to win that match. Before the defeat Meanwhile, Bournemouth has had a series of 7 wins and 1 draw in 8 matches. They are well organized and will be ready to put pressure on Liverpool, and I have a feeling they will gain something from this match.” .

These are two notable matches in the Premier League this weekend. In addition, there are still 3 other matches. West Ham, after the shock of being defeated by lower-ranked team Bristol City in the FA Cup, did not receive high praise from expert Sutton, as he commented that The Hammers would be split points in their away trip to the field of bottom-ranked team Sheffield United. .

A team that is fighting for relegation, Nottingham, will have a trip to Brentford’s stadium and according to expert Sutton’s prediction, home field advantage will help coach Thomas Frank’s team win. Similarly, England’s leading football expert has faith in another home team, Brighton, to overcome Wolves in the latest match of round 21.
